About the role
The Manager, Growth Marketing owns the execution of digital demand generation programs that drive new pipeline and support customer expansion. This role is responsible for the day-to-day operation of paid media, SEO/AEO tactics, and nurture programs β building and running the channels that move prospects and customers through the funnel.
This role works within the Revenue Marketing team. Strategy, account prioritization, and program sequencing are set by the Sr. Director of Revenue Marketing; the Manager, Growth Marketing executes the digital and programmatic programs that bring that strategy to life.
Why this job is exciting
Digital demand generation
β’ Execute paid search, paid social, display/retargeting, and content syndication programs in support of pipeline targets set by Revenue Marketing
β’ Implement SEO and AEO tactics in partnership with the SVP of Marketing and Content team
β’ Run A/B testing and conversion rate optimization across landing pages, forms, and CTAs
β’ Track and report on conversion from lead to qualified pipeline, including MQL-to-SQL rates and channel-level performance
Nurture and lifecycle programs
β’ Build and manage nurture sequences, lead scoring logic, and lifecycle email programs within the marketing automation platform
β’ Support programmatic customer growth through automated adoption sequences, expansion triggers, and engagement programs
β’ Partner with CS and Revenue Marketing on lifecycle and expansion program execution
Marketing operations collaboration
β’ Work with the marketing ops function on Salesforce/HubSpot reporting, attribution, and data hygiene
β’ Coordinate on lead management, routing, and lead scoring optimization
β’ Serve as a day-to-day point of contact with marketing ops, flagging issues and keeping programs running cleanly
About you
β’ 4β6 years of experience in demand generation, growth marketing, or digital marketing in B2B SaaS
β’ Hands-on experience with CRM and marketing automation platforms (HubSpot preferred)
β’ Comfortable owning paid media execution across search, social, and display
β’ Familiarity with multi-touch attribution models and pipeline reporting
β’ Experience building or maintaining nurture and lifecycle programs
β’ Analytical and detail-oriented, with a bias toward action over analysis
β’ Experience with intent signal platforms (6sense, Demandbase) is a plus
β’ Comfortable operating with some ambiguity and building programs without a lot of pre-existing infrastructure
What success looks like
β’ Paid media campaigns are live, optimized, and tied to clear pipeline targets within 30 days of start
β’ AEO tactics are implemented and Syndio appears in top results on ChatGPT, Perplexity, and other AI search tools for target queries
β’ Nurture programs are running with measurable conversion rates and clear visibility into where leads qualify or fall out
β’ Reporting is clean and attribution is reliable β pipeline reviews are grounded in numbers the team trusts
